What Single-Family Building Permits Reveal About Fresno's Future Housing Market

Single-Family Building Permits Fresno, construction site with machinery and house.

Understanding the Current Landscape of Fresno's Housing Market

For many residents of Fresno, the complexities of building permits may seem like dry bureaucracy, but they serve as crucial indicators of the housing market's health. At first glance, the numbers behind single-family building permits may not trigger much excitement during a weekend breakfast discussion, but a closer look can provide valuable insights into the local real estate dynamics.

Every time a builder files a permit, they are making a significant gamble, investing both time and money on the belief that there will be sufficient demand to justify their projects. In essence, these permits reflect confidence in the area — an uptick in permits usually signifies a booming market, while declines can indicate hesitance or economic uncertainty.

Current Permit Trends: A Mixed Picture

Recent data from Fresno County illustrates a pivotal moment for single-family home permits. After a surge during the pandemic years, where construction seemed to be at a high point, numbers have now begun to slow down. Areas like Clovis and parts of Southeast Fresno are still seeing development, but the overall trend post-2020 shows a significant decline:

  • 2020: 3,450 permits issued
  • 2021: 3,890 permits issued (+12.7%)
  • 2022: 3,020 permits issued (-22.4%)
  • 2023: 2,475 permits issued (-18.0%)
  • 2024 (YTD): 1,030 permits (on track for ~2,060)

These figures illustrate a stark change within a few years, as builders grapple with several external factors that inhibit their operations. Notably, increased interest rates have escalated borrowing costs for builders and homebuyers alike, effectively constraining the market’s upward potential.

Why Should Residents Care?

Understanding the implications of building permits goes beyond mere statistics. They serve as barometers for future growth, signaling where the economy might be heading. For instance, if permits remain stagnant or decrease further, it can forecast a limited supply of homes — a situation that may drive prices higher in the long run, making housing less accessible for potential buyers.

Fresno's residents deserve insights into how these permits affect their community. As fewer homes enter the market, those seeking to buy in the area may find themselves competing for a short supply, potentially leading to price increases and diminished affordability.

Exploring Contributing Factors

The slowdown in single-family home permits doesn't exist in a vacuum; it is crucial to consider the multifaceted factors at play:

1. Interest Rates

As interest rates rise, borrowing costs increase dramatically for builders and buyers. This situation discourages new construction projects and curtails home purchases, which are foundational to sustaining robust housing supply. The ongoing fluctuations in interest rates can spike uncertainty, making future investments in the housing market seem riskier.

2. Material and Labor Costs

In addition to financing challenges, builders face skyrocketing prices for materials and labor. With supply chain disruptions still impacting availability, builders may be hesitant to undertake new projects unless there is clear market demand to incentivize their investments.

3. Existing Inventory

Many builders are still working through unsold inventory from earlier projects, meaning they might not prioritize new builds until past homes have sold. This backlog can skew perceptions of the overall housing market and add to the uncertainty faced by potential new buyers.

Why September in Fresno Is the Ultimate Harvest Experience

Update Fresno's Hidden Gem: The September Harvest CelebrationAs the summer heat wanes, a cheerful transformation takes place in Fresno and Clovis during September, marking the beginning of the local harvest season. Forget Napa Valley, where many flock for their wine-themed excursions; right here in the heart of the San Joaquin Valley, our own harvest celebration is rich with authenticity, community spirit, and flavors that are second to none.The Pulse of Agriculture: What September Means for FresnoSeptember brings with it the unmistakable rhythm of the Valley's agricultural life. Grapes are harvested, raisins spread across the sunlit fields, and the last remnants of figs and peaches tantalize fruit lovers. Fresno County is the world's top producer of raisins, a detail often overshadowed by the allure of more popular wine destinations. But let’s appreciate what we have; the rows of luscious grapes that are found here not only become wine but also represent years of heritage and labor from dedicated farmers.Upcoming Events: Join the CelebrationsOne of the best parts of September is the vibrant community events that come alive this time of year. The ClovisFest is a local favorite, taking center stage with hot air balloons gliding against the morning sky, vendors bustling in Old Town, and an array of live entertainment that showcases the rich tapestry of local talent. If you haven't attended, imagine the sights and sounds reminiscent of classic Americana — all without long drives or crowded hotels.Local Wineries: An Upsurge in ProduceThis month isn't just about community festivities; local wineries are also brimming with excitement. They frequently offer grape stomping activities and guided tours that immerse you in the harvest experience. It’s more than just fun; it’s about connecting with the land and celebrating a season where every grape stomped resonates with the Valley's agricultural legacy.Farmers Markets: A Feast for the SensesSeptember also showcases some of the best offerings at our local farmers markets.
